At 11:57 +0000 UTC, on 2006-10-21, email@hidden wrote:
> Was I dreaming or is there not a built-in scripting addition to encode
> text (to) HTML entities?
I'm afraid you were dreaming ;)
I'm aware of 2 third-party solutions
- Unicode Checker, a scriptable app: <http://earthlingsoft.net/UnicodeChecker/>
- has' TextCommands Scripting Addition:
<http://freespace.virgin.net/hamish.sanderson/index.html>
But I'm with Emmanuel: why not just write as «class utf8»? (You'll probably
still need to URL-encode though, which the above tools can do for you.)
